About

Medivet St Ives Cambridge is a companion animal practice on Station Road in St Ives, near Huntingdon. Co-owned by partner vet Evgeni Hristoskov, it treats cats, dogs, rabbits, exotic species, birds, reptiles and small mammals as part of the Medivet network.

The practice holds Cat Friendly Clinic accreditation and provides orthopaedics, endoscopy, cardiology, dental care, grooming and diagnostic imaging. Laboratory diagnostics, physiotherapy, pet passports and microchipping are also offered. The branch has step-free access and a free car park.
